bool rename ( string oldname, string newname [, resource context] )
下面演示rename的具體應(yīng)用:
文件位置如圖:

目的:1.把cache.txt 更名為rename.txt;
2.將cache2.txt更名為cache3.txt
3.將html目錄 更名為 cache
4.將file目錄轉(zhuǎn)移到html目錄下(可以實(shí)現(xiàn)更名)
代碼實(shí)現(xiàn)(有錯(cuò)誤):
復(fù)制代碼 代碼如下:
<?php
$file = "html/cache.txt";
$rename = "html/rename.txt";
if(rename($file,$rename)){
echo "更名成功";
}else{
echo "更名失敗";
}
rename("html/cache2","html/cache3.txt");
rename("html","cache");
rename("file","html/files");
?>
常見(jiàn)錯(cuò)誤分析:

檢查語(yǔ)法,無(wú)問(wèn)題;經(jīng)查file目錄不存在,導(dǎo)致錯(cuò)誤。更為files編譯成功
這個(gè)錯(cuò)誤小啊,致命啊
php技術(shù):php Rename 更改文件、文件夾名稱,轉(zhuǎn)載需保留來(lái)源!
鄭重聲明:本文版權(quán)歸原作者所有,轉(zhuǎn)載文章僅為傳播更多信息之目的,如作者信息標(biāo)記有誤,請(qǐng)第一時(shí)間聯(lián)系我們修改或刪除,多謝。